Output 364186ea6fb93a3960c5362e81b17318240699cac9aadb996ee31385adffad50:84

value
2328000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46ac02b6cd67babdf63bf2dd24900bc68315827f OP_EQUALVERIFY OP_CHECKSIG
address
17SgMwBtAjuUfyKStro99yEF8NH6qbeJ9e
transaction
364186ea6fb93a3960c5362e81b17318240699cac9aadb996ee31385adffad50
confirmations
178856
spent
true